Question: If supply could be traced through Denmark and Sweden (for whatever reason) would the following apply and allow Mannerheim to be in supply by tracing rail all the way to Berlin across the Malmo - Copenhagen strait?

Railway supply paths
A hex a railway supply path enters, by moving along a railway or road, does not count against the 4 hex limit. A hex it enters across a straits hexside also does not count against the limit, so long as the hexes on either side of the straits are railway hexes.


Or do people think this only applies when the rail symbol actually connects across the straight as occurs in the rest of Denmark and Kerch?

Yes, it appies, since there is a railway in both Malmö and Copenhagen. There doesn't need to be a continuing railroad between Berlin and Mannerheim...

The fact that there is no railway connexxion between the two cities effects the railmovement phase (or the movement phase if you use the railmovement optional rule). You can rail only one unit across the strait between Malmö to Berlin and an unlimited number from Copenhagen to Berlin depending on action limits, of course).

RAC - Page 65 - Only 1 unit a side can rail move across each straits hexside in a turn.
RAC - Page 100 - Each resource cannot cross more than 1 straits hexside.

Cannot see a restriction on RR supply.
